var str01 = "你好我的博客世界"
var str02 = "qwertyvSDCV"
1、str01.charAt()
返回值是指定索引位置的字符串,超出索引,结果是空字符串。
2、str01.charCodeAt()
返回在指定的位置的字符的 Unicode 编码。
3、str01.concat(‘哈哈‘, ‘呵呵‘, true)
拼接字符串,返回的是拼接之后的新的字符串。
4、str01.indexOf()
(要找的字符串,从某个位置开始的索引);返回的是这个字符串的索引值,没找到则返回-1
5、str01.lastIndexOf()
(要找的字符串,从某个位置开始的索引);从后向前找,但是索引仍然是从左向右的方式,找不到则返回-1
6、str01.replace()
("原来的字符串","新的字符串");用来替换字符串的
7、str01.slice()
(开始的索引,结束的索引); 从索引的位置开始提取,到索引的前一个结束,并返回这个提取后的字符串. 负索引是从字符串最后一个,-1就是最后一个字符
8、str01.substring()
(开始的索引,结束的索引); 从索引的位置开始提取,到索引的前一个结束,并返回这个提取后的字符串, substring不能有负数的索引,获取自己想要的字符串
9、str01.substr()
(开始的索引,个数);返回的是截取后的新的字符串
10、str01.substr()
(开始的索引,个数);返回的是截取后的新的字符串
11、str02.toLocaleLowerCase()
把字符串转成小写
12、str02.toLocaleUpperCase()
把字符串转成大写
13、str01.trim()
去掉字符串两端空格
14、str04.split(‘|‘)
按照指定的字符串进行切割,返回一个数组
ES6字符串语法
1、str01.includes(‘你好‘)
判断是否包含指定的字符串
2、str01.startsWith(‘你好‘)
判断是否以指定字符串开头
3、str02.endsWith(‘2‘)
判断是否以指定字符串结束
4、str01.repeat(2)
按照指定的字符串进行切割,返回一个数组
原文:https://www.cnblogs.com/lybweb/p/14880327.html